From: Sunita Sarawagi <sunita@cs...>  20120321 17:58:41

Xu Chu wrote: > Hi > > Is there currently implementation of getting Topk segmentation of an address? > Yes, you can get that by calling: public Segmentation[] SegmentCRF.segmentSequences(CandSegDataSequence dataSeq, int numLabelSeqs, double scores[]) This will return the topk segmentations and will set the scores[] array to the probability of each segmentation. > And How can I get the probability of each segmentation? > If you need to estimate the probability of an arbitrary given segmentation, you will have to make two calls s = crf.getScore() l = crf.getLogZx(). The probabilty is then: exp(sl) > > Thanks > Xu 